Ok, after much testing - think I found the formula....42grain Griffin LDC BTs - modified. Inserted a .2mm SS ball bearing in the end and oh boy its shoots. Better BC and hits hard like a normal solid nose bullet yet retains the expansion characteristics inherent to the LDC. Pic is 6 shots @ 100yrds averaging 920 or so. Tried the same with my .22 Veteran short but that CZ barrel, it loves pellets but not slugs so much and im partial to slugs so....guess I'll be swapping the CZ for a LW poly here shortly
...Taipan Veteran Standard, modified valve/transfer ports, two of the ER plenums, polished 23.5 inch LW polygonal barrel, trigger job, modified barrel shroud off a Taipan Long, and a STO Sarissa moderator, Burris HD scope, and an old school adjustable Morgan butt stock. Hated the gray laminated stock so its been hacked up a bit as well
